Patient and Family Participation in Care Planning
Involving the patient and family in growth care into practice means:
- Being aware of the composition of the family
- Asking about and addressing patient and family concerns about growth, puberty, and development
- Assessing the family’s well-being and identifying and addressing psychosocial issues
- Providing education
- Building on family strengths
- Partnering with families to openly communicate all suspected and confirmed growth/pubertal disorders and to provide appropriate and timely follow-up services, education, and resources in a culturally sensitive, understandable format
